For Media Buyers
-
Pricing Groups Give Schools More Control Over CPI
A key challenge for media buyers is finding ways to effectively model complex media plans on their lead capture system. Buyers need to price differently for different campaigns and affiliates – by school, campus, or program, or by other inquiry attributes such as online vs. ground, military affiliation, or quality grade. Sparkroom’s new Pricing Groups feature enables buyers to define granular matching characteristics for inbound inquiries, and set the CPI for leads accordingly. This versatility enables buyers to implement their strategy with affiliates – for example, by setting a single CPI for some affiliates, while configuring different CPIs by program for others. And all pricing configuration feeds automatically into Sparkroom’s industry leading cost and conversion analytics.

Cap Alerts Help Prevent Accidental Overcap
Buyers need to keep close track of inbound lead volume day by day, understand which vendors are pacing to their allocation with quality leads and which are not, and adjust caps on the fly. Sparkroom’s alerting framework now supports Cap Alerts that enable buyers to receive email notifications when affiliates are pacing to exceed caps or are having their inquiries rejected because they are overcap.

Post-delivery Rejection Alerts Allow Quicker Notification of Rejected Inquiries
Buying media is not a simple transaction any more – as buyers implement different downstream solutions for verifying and evaluating inquiries, the definition of a ‘bad inquiry’ gets more complex. For example, inquiries can be accepted as good initially, then quickly scrubbed out by a verifying Call Center. If buyers do not want to pay for those inquiries, they need a way to quickly alert their affiliates when this occurs. Sparkroom’s alerting framework now supports email notifications that let affiliates know when recently submitted leads have been scrubbed by a downstream system or process.
For Compliance and Branding Officers
-
Landing Page Compliance
Increasingly, media buyers in the education space need an end-to-end audit trail for their sources, from landing page to submission to enrolment. Sparkroom’s integration with the PerformMatch™ platform from PerformLine, a leading campaign verification platform in the education market, enables compliance officers to:
- Automatically score the submission form for each web inquiry based on known best practices in private education marketing,
- Take and store a screen capture of each inquiry-generating web impression in a searchable repository for review and auditing, and
- Analyze lead providers’ relative compliance posture, identify clean and problematic vendors, and allocate budget accordingly.
For Finance
-
Billable Inquiries
While not an invoicing platform, Sparkroom is typically the system of record when it comes to end-of-month reconciliation with vendors. As inquiry transactions become more complex, it becomes increasingly important to track and understand which inquiries are billable and which are not, and to share this information with affiliates in a timely way. To help, Sparkroom now supports a Billable status for each inquiry that can be set manually, or tied to events in the inquiry lifecycle (e.g. overcap submissions, duplicate scrubs, downstream call center rejections). To support reconciliation, Sparkroom analytics now provide measures for tracking the ‘billable’ inquiry count, in addition to good inquiry counts and rejection rates.
